condominium

IPA: kɑndʌmˈɪniʌm

noun

  • Joint sovereignty over a territory by two or more countries.
  • A region or territory under such rule.
  • (US, Canada, Philippines) A building or complex of buildings that provides multiple residential units each of which is owned separately but whose grounds, structure, etc. (if any) are owned jointly.
  • (US, Canada, Philippines) The system of ownership by which such condominiums operate
  • (US, Canada, Philippines) An individual unit (such as an apartment) in such a complex.
  • The legal tenure involved.
